The White Widow strain is a hybrid cannabis strain that emerged in the 1990s. It is a cross between a Brazilian sativa and an Indian indica. This combination results in a balanced high that appeals to many users. With its impressive THC levels—often ranging from 18% to 25%—White Widow gorilla auto seeds marijuana delivers not just potency but also an array of complex flavors and aromas.
The origins of White Widow are steeped in mystery, but it's widely believed to have been developed by Green House Seeds in Amsterdam. Its name comes from the white trichomes that cover its buds, resembling frost on a winter morning. The lineage of this strain infuses it with characteristics that make it appealing for both recreational and medicinal users.

The aroma of any cannabis strain plays a pivotal role in its overall appeal, and for White Widow, this is no different. The scent profile can be described as earthy and pungent, with hints of sweetness intertwined with notes reminiscent of pine and citrus.
The aroma directly influences not just how we perceive cannabis but also how it affects us physically and mentally. Many users report that different scents can evoke various emotions or memories—making each session feel like a personalized experience.
Terpenes are organic compounds found in many plants—including cannabis—that contribute to aroma and flavor profiles. For White Widow weed, several key terpenes play significant roles:
Different terpenes are believed to work synergistically with cannabinoids like THC to create what’s known as "the entourage effect." This means that not only do these terpenes enhance flavor and aroma but they also influence the overall effects experienced by users.
The concept behind the entourage effect posits that when all components of cannabis work together—the cannabinoids alongside terpenes—they produce enhanced therapeutic benefits compared to isolated compounds alone.
